Description: The West Virginia Salaried Employee Appraisal Guidelines — General provide a framework for conducting performance evaluations and offering feedback to salaried employees in the state of West Virginia. These guidelines outline a structured process for assessing employee performance, identifying areas of improvement, and promoting career development. The appraisal process is designed to evaluate employee performance based on predetermined objectives, goals, and competencies. By utilizing a standardized rating scale, supervisors can measure employee performance consistently across different departments and roles within the organization. These guidelines define the rating scale and provide detailed instructions on how to assign ratings based on specific performance criteria. The West Virginia Salaried Employee Appraisal Guidelines — General emphasize the importance of the feedback process. Supervisors are encouraged to provide constructive feedback to employees, focusing on both strengths and areas for improvement. This feedback not only helps employees understand their performance but also serves as a catalyst for growth and professional development. There may be variations in the appraisal guidelines based on specific departments or job positions. For example, the West Virginia Salaried Employee Appraisal Guidelines — Sales Department may include additional performance metrics tailored to sales targets, customer satisfaction, and relationship management. Similarly, the West Virginia Salaried Employee Appraisal Guidelines — IT Department may include technical competencies and project management skills as additional evaluation criteria. In addition to evaluating performance, these guidelines also recognize the importance of career development and compensation. By identifying areas for improvement, supervisors can help employees align their goals with the organization's objectives and chart a career path. The appraisal process is often linked to compensation decisions, allowing for transparent and merit-based reward systems. Overall, the West Virginia Salaried Employee Appraisal Guidelines — General provide a comprehensive and structured approach to performance evaluation, feedback, and professional development for salaried employees in West Virginia. Implemented effectively, these guidelines promote employee growth, enhance organizational performance, and foster a positive work culture.
